The identification of autoantigens remains a critical challenge for
understanding and treating autoimmune diseases. Autoimmune polyendocrine
syndrome type 1 (APS1), a rare monogenic form of autoimmunity, presents as
widespread autoimmunity with T and B cell responses to multiple organs.
Importantly, autoantibody discovery in APS1 can illuminate fundamental
disease pathogenesis, and many of the antigens found in APS1 extend to
common autoimmune diseases. Here, we performed proteome-wide programmable
phage-display (PhIP-Seq) on sera from an APS1 cohort and discovered
multiple common antibody targets. These novel autoantigens exhibit
tissue-restricted expression, including expression in enteroendocrine
cells and dental enamel. Using detailed clinical phenotyping, we find
novel associations between autoantibodies and organ-restricted
autoimmunity, including between anti-KHDC3L autoantibodies and premature
ovarian insufficiency, and between anti-RFX6 autoantibodies and
diarrheal-type intestinal dysfunction. Our study highlights the utility of
PhIP-Seq for interrogating antigenic repertoires in human autoimmunity and
the importance of antigen discovery for improved understanding of disease
mechanisms.
